Alabama football will be in trouble on offense against Indiana if the Crimson Tide is one-dimensional, according to Nick Saban.
The Crimson Tide has struggled to run the football at times this season, and it has leaned on Ty Simpson for a good portion of its offensive production. Saban said this can not happen in the Rose Bowl on Thursday.

“I think if Alabama’s going to be one-dimensional, they’re going to have a hard time in this game and they’re going to play against a very, very good defensive team,” Saban said.
